  • 117 3 JAPANESE EMICRATION TO AMER ICA. A SUBSTANTIAL DECREASE. It appears from I Team despatch thai the number of Japanese immigrants who arrived ii America during September w I. a decrease of 500 as compared with the corresponding month of last year. The number of immigrants from all countries in September

  • 118 3 APPRECIATION IN ENGLAND A London telegram of Nov. tl, which has been communicated to us by the Osaka Maiuiclu -tates that the rapidity of construction and efficiency of the new Japanese armoured cruiser, Ibuki (which was launched on i hursday) are appreciated in England.
